    I just now got back from a small train show in St. Pete FL. and Kato San Ceo of Kato-USA was there with a table set up showing off their latest in HO and N, of particular interest to N was the sample casting of the new 90MAC! Just the main body is made of five seperate castings the Cab, the Backend and the two Radiator housings all on the main hood! It is another 'count the fan blades' type of detail that has come to be exspected of Kato.
